The taste of soda is first of all water quality. Everything else is the recipe

The basis of any soft drink is water. In most cases it goes through reverse osmosis to become a "neutral" base for the recipe. Then comes final filtration before bottling, sterile air to displace oxygen, and cleanliness at every step.

Water is the main ingredient. Everything depends on its purity

Soda, juices, water – 80–99% of the drink's composition

Water in a soft drink is not just a "solvent". Any foreign smell, aftertaste or contamination – and the batch is lost. Producers use reverse osmosis to make the water neutral, but the system itself needs protection.

A common situation

A plant installed a reverse osmosis system, but the membranes fail after 8–12 months instead of the stated 3 years. The reason is almost always the same – no proper pre-filtration at the inlet. One membrane costs 10–30 times more than the pre-filter that would have protected it.

Air and CO₂ touch the product during bottling – this is also a source of risk

Filling into PET, glass, Tetra Pak, oxygen displacement, container purging

Bottling uses compressed air or carbon dioxide – to displace oxygen, create counter-pressure, and purge containers before filling. If this air is not sterile, bacteria get into the product at exactly this moment, after the whole process.

An important detail about CO₂

The carbon dioxide for carbonation also needs filtration. Gas from an external source may contain foreign particles and microorganisms – especially if returned CO₂ is used.
